like you who can continue to elevate our work and culture. General
Purpose of Job The Director of New Business is responsible for
enabling and accelerating revenue growth by leading and supporting
the new business process from RFI through final decision. This role
partners closely with opportunity leads to facilitate the entire
pitch process, ensuring teams are focused, equipped, and positioned
to win new business. The Director of New Business oversees the
development and execution of new business pitches by translating
complex client needs into compelling, insight-led proposals across
targeted accounts and industries. This role works closely with
agency and pitch team leadership by managing new business resources
(including project management, design, copywriting, etc.) with
speed and efficiency, ensuring high-quality output under tight
timelines. As a senior leader, the Director of New Business
balances strategy with hands-on execution and plays a critical role
in elevating how the agency competes, presents, and delivers in
every pitch. This is a highly collaborative, roll-up-your-sleeves
role for someone who can lean in, make decisions, and get the job
done well. This role includes, but is not limited to, the following
key areas of activity: - RFI/RFP development - Research and audit
insights - Presentation development and support - Pitch process and
workflow management - SOW development and support Key
Responsibilities New Business Enablement - Partner with pitch
leadership to define and execute the new business process from
opportunity RFI through proposal submission and presentation. -
Develop and maintain frameworks, tools, and processes that enable
the new business team to pursue opportunities efficiently and
effectively. - Lead the creation of proposals, credentials, and
pitch materials that clearly articulate the agency’s value,
approach, and differentiation. - Translate client business
challenges and objectives into clear, compelling stories that
resonate with mid-market decision-makers. - Ensure every pitch
reflects a strong point of view, practical thinking, and a deep
understanding of the prospect’s needs and priorities. - Prepare new
business team and agency leadership for presentations by aligning
messaging, defining roles, and ensuring Q&A readiness. - Stay
informed on industry trends, competitive dynamics, and emerging
client needs to continuously refine new business strategy and
approach. Team Leadership & Development - Lead the sales support
team responsible for RFP responses, proposals, pitch development,
and presentations. - Oversee end-to-end pitch execution, including
discovery, story development, solution design, pricing
coordination, and final delivery. - Establish and maintain best
practices for pitch quality, messaging consistency, and overall new
business excellence. - Recruit, mentor, and develop a
high-performing team with a strong sense of ownership,
accountability, and collaboration. - Foster a culture of curiosity,
continuous improvement, and results-driven execution. - Operate as
a hands-on, working leader who actively contributes to pitches and
problem-solving as needed. - Track, analyze, and report on new
business performance metrics, including pipeline health, win rates,
deal size, and profitability. Cross-Functional Collaboration -
Partner closely with Strategy, Creative, Media, Data, and Client
Services leaders to develop integrated, insight-driven solutions. -
Facilitate focused internal working sessions to uncover insights,
define scope, and align teams around the recommended approach. -
Lead support for pitches, ensuring teams stay aligned, accountable,
and focused throughout the process. Job Requirements Education:
